New! Immaculate Heart of Mary ? Benziger ? based on a Vintage Holy Card ? Catholic Art Print ? Archival Quality This beautiful Immaculate Heart was done in the late 19th Century by G. Benziger of Switzerland, who in our opinion was maybe the only publisher outside of France who could compete with the French holy cards in terms of beauty and elegance. It was done for the Marian shrine at Einsiedeln, Switzerland, one of the great European pilgrimages to Our Lady. Einsiedeln is still popular today, and was especially popular in the 19th Century before Lourdes, Fatima, and even Lisieux. The devotion to the Immaculate Heart of Mary has a long history. According to EWTN, it became popular in the 17th Century through the work of St. John Eudes, a French priest who had a great love of the Blessed Mother. By the 19th Century, the devotion was widespread throughout the Church.The Sacred Heart version is also beautiful.
